Coming off of methadone is more intense than that of heroin, given, as i'm sure you've heard, "half life, and potency."  I started at 20mg a day and quit c/t at 5 mgs. I was only on it for about 2 months and still went through 3 weeks of withdrawls....i would stay on it the absolute LEAST amount of time possible....this demon is MUCH harder to kick.  Please be advised before the walls close in.  Keep posting.  Lots of great people and info. here.  Good luck.

For me personally, I was addicted to oxys & jumped off of oxys straight onto methadone, they started me at 40mgs, which was tolerated ok, but within days, I was moved up to 70mgs, thats where I stayed for a few weeks, then I was moved up to 90, where I stayed at for quite a while, now Im at 4mgs & yearning to get off this junk! I cant say your doing the wrong thing, as who am I to speak? But I so wish I would have had someone around when I was first introduced to methadone who told me exactly how hard it would be to get off of it, & who explained to me how the half life with methadone works etc, I was merely warned about the long drives & the daily visits to the clinic, the group meetings,blah,blah,blah. Everyones different & methadone kinda builds & builds in the body over time, so Im thinking in a few days you should begin to feel better, If thats what you want to call it, as I never,ever felt like I was truly me during my time on it, no emotions, no ambitions, no feelings, methadone kinda masked all my ability to feel & once you begin to taper, its like someones pealing back layers and layers of your clothing, soon you are naked to all these emotions that you were feeling prior to methadone, & I think this is when relapse is at its highest, suddenly this desire of drinking or using starts creeping up in your brain, & this is the time you use the tools that were learned in your sobriety, so I really hope if you stay on methadone that you take advantage of this time off heroin & seek some support & guidance.
